What are the height and setback rules for a fence here?
Zoning limits are 4 feet in front yards and 8 feet in rear yards. The setback is 0 feet, meaning you can build on your property line. For corner lots, maintain a clear 'sight triangle' for traffic visibility, especially near high-speed routes like I-565.
How deep should fence posts be set in Redstone Arsenal?
Posts must be set at least 12 inches below the frost line to prevent frost heave. The IRC requires this for stability in the Redstone Arsenal Residential Area, where shallow footings shift and fail. We pour concrete footings to meet this standard.
What fence materials work best given the soil and pests?
Factor in Very Heavy termite risk and Moderate soil corrosivity. Pressure-treated pine requires ground-contact rating and regular termite inspections. For metal, use aluminum or hot-dip galvanized steel with stainless steel fasteners to prevent rust streaks from corrosion.
Is my fence designed for high winds?
The design wind load is 115 MPH V-ult. This engineering rating dictates post spacing, concrete footing size, and bracket strength. Fences not built to ASCE 7-22 standards for this wind speed will fail during peak storm season gusts common to the region.

What are the neighbor notification laws for a fence in Redstone Arsenal?
Alabama Code Section 35-3-1 is the 'Good Neighbor Fence Law'. It requires written notice to adjoining property owners before constructing a shared boundary fence. In 2026, this notice is a legal prerequisite, even on a Federal installation like Redstone Arsenal.
Can I have a smart gate with a pool?
Yes. Integrated IoT latches and smart gates are a moderate trend. They must also comply with IRC Appendix AG pool safety codes, which mandate self-closing, self-latching mechanisms. Modern systems combine remote access with these mandatory safety features to limit liability.
What is required before digging post holes?
You must call Alabama 811 for utility locates. Hitting a power or comms line in the Redstone Arsenal Residential Area carries major liability and repair costs. We manage this call and all required permit office paperwork to ensure the project starts correctly.
